Utah State University Honors Bobby Wagner with an Unprecedented Ceremony
Utah State University has a tradition of honoring exceptional individuals with honorary doctorates, and this year, the tradition climbed to new heights. Wagner received his honorary doctorate at the 139th commencement ceremony, a significant milestone that celebrated 6,335 graduates and Wagner's own extraordinary legacy. The event marked a pivotal moment for Wagner, transforming him from a beloved sports figure into a respected academic, all under the banner of Utah State.
The Humor and Heart Behind Wagner's Commencement Speech
Wagner's speech at the commencement ceremony was a blend of humor, personal anecdotes, and profound advice. He humorously asked family members to start calling him "Dr. Bobby" instead of Bobby, turning a solemn academic moment into a lighthearted family joke. This playful request not only added a personal touch to the ceremony but also highlighted Wagner's ability to connect with his audience on a deeper, more meaningful level. His message underscored the importance of networking, remaining genuine, and the fearlessness needed to seize opportunities.
Wagner's speech was not just about personal success but also about the pride of being part of the Utah State community. He frequently referred to the university as "The" Utah State, emphasizing his deep connection and pride in his alma mater.
